17-7-123 . Form of executive budget.

(1)The budget submitted must set forth a balanced financial plan for funds subject to appropriation, as provided in 17-8-101 , for each accounting entity and for the state government for each fiscal year of the ensuing biennium. The budget must consist of:
(a)a consolidated budget summary setting forth the aggregate figures of the budget in a manner that shows a balance between the total proposed disbursements and the total anticipated receipts, together with the other means of financing the budget for each fiscal year of the ensuing biennium, contrasted with the corresponding figures for the last-completed fiscal year and the fiscal year in progress. The consolidated budget summary must be supported by explanatory schedules or statements.
